Melissa and Tammy Etheridge have ended their nearly nine year relationship, a spokesperson for the couple confirmed to People magazine.

"Melissa and Tammy Etheridge are saddened to announce that they are now separated," Melissa's rep told People. The couple added in a statement: "We ask for consideration and respect for our family as we go through this difficult period."

Melissa, 48, and Tammy, 35, exchanged vows in Malibu in September, 2003, when Tammy still went by her professional name, Tammy Lynn Michaels. In 2006, Tammy gave birth to twins, son Miller and daughter Johnnie Rose.

The two stayed together through Melissa's breast cancer in 2004, and Melissa credited Tammy with being a huge part of her recovery.

Melissa is also the mother of two children -- 13-year-old Bailey and 11-year-old Beckett -- with former partner Julie Cypher.
